    I was concerned at first about the three skill limit, but with the favorites wheel, I think it's gonna be jut a lot of fun. I'm so excited to have a Vanguard-esque set where I can CHARGE-NOVA-NOVA everywhere, but also a Sentinel-esque set like my ME3 set where I could set and trigger pretty much every type of explosion combo in the game (will be more limited with only three slots but same principle).

    CAN I JUST SCREAM ABOUT SENTINEL IN ME3 FOR A SEC BC IT'S SO FUN. I'm playing on Veteran for the first time recently and just actually realizing that combos are a thing. Sentinels can easily prime 3/4 (biotic, cryo, and electric) and if you want you can get fire with the extra skill and take Carnage or Incendiary ammo. Also if you're watching your weight and take the cooldown reducing options, Throw has next to no cool down and can detonate all of them. Tech armor makes you super durable on top of everything. On lower difficulties and protection missions (Like Surkesh) you can basically just stand in front of the thing you're protecting and kill everything while shots just bounce right off you. It's so satisfying, especially after how crappy sentinel was in the first game.
